Embracing Differences: A Harmonious Dance of Individuality

The song "EXAGERADO" by Jônatas Braga delves into the theme of individuality and the acceptance of differences between people. The lyrics repeatedly emphasize the contrast between two individuals who perceive and approach life in distinct ways. This contrast is highlighted through the recurring motif of walking and doing things differently, symbolizing the unique paths each person takes in life. The song's protagonist questions why they are perceived as "exaggerated," suggesting a sense of misunderstanding or misjudgment from others who do not share the same perspective or lifestyle.

The repetition of the phrase "Você é de um jeito eu sou de outro" ("You are one way, I am another") underscores the idea that diversity in behavior and thought is natural and should be respected. The song advocates for a harmonious coexistence where each person can remain true to themselves without imposing their ways on others. This message is encapsulated in the line "Fica do seu lado, eu fico no meu lado" ("You stay on your side, I stay on mine"), which suggests a mutual respect for personal space and individuality.

Jônatas Braga's "EXAGERADO" resonates with listeners who have experienced being labeled or misunderstood due to their unique traits or behaviors. The song encourages embracing one's true self and respecting others' differences, promoting a message of acceptance and understanding. This theme is particularly relevant in today's diverse and multicultural societies, where individuality is both celebrated and challenged. Through its catchy rhythm and relatable lyrics, "EXAGERADO" invites listeners to reflect on their perceptions of others and the importance of embracing diversity in all its forms.
